Fluid - Differential: Service and Repair

Lubricant Change
1. Raise the vehicle. Support the vehicle. Refer to Vehicle Lifting.
2. Place a drain pan or suitable container under the rear axle housing.
3. Remove the rear axle housing oil level/filler plug from the rear axle housing.
4. Remove the rear axle housing drain plug from the rear axle housing and drain the rear axle housing.

Notice: Refer to Fastener Notice in Service Precautions.

5. After the rear axle housing has completely drained, install the rear axle housing drain plug with a new gasket into the rear axle housing.
^ Tighten the rear axle housing drain plug to 39 Nm (29 ft. lbs.).
6. Refill the rear axle housing with approximately 0.5 liters (1.0 pts) of 80W-90 GL5 lubricant GM P/N 12345977 (Canadian P/N 10953482), or equivalent. The oil level should be even with the bottom of the rear axle housing oil level/filler plug hole.
7. Install the rear axle housing oil level/filler plug with a new gasket into the rear axle housing.
^ Tighten the rear axle housing oil level/filler plug to 39 Nm (29 ft. lbs.).
8. Remove the drain pan from under the rear axle housing.
9. Lower the vehicle.
